Moody’s warns on Portuguese sub debt, more optimistic on Spain
Rating agency Moody’s put on review for possible downgrade the ratings of Portuguese banks and said that it would be reviewing the extent to which systemic support would continue to remain applicable to more junior capital instruments of Portuguese banks.
